Rouven Kasper, Chief Marketing and Sales Officer of Bayern Munich, spoke at a press conference on August 20, 2026, emphasizing the potential brand boost if Harry Kane were to win the Ballon d'Or. Kasper stated that Kane's victory would signify a strong position for Bayern, highlighting the significance of individual awards in global marketing. While the discussion includes other candidates like Michael Olisé, Kane is currently viewed as the leading contender for the prestigious award. Bayern has not had a Ballon d'Or winner since the 21st century and looks to change that narrative with Kane's potential success this year.
